Hey,
ich würde gern das Tabnav
Pluginhttp://blog.seesaw.it/articles/2006/07/23/the-easiest-way-to-add-tabbed-navigation-to-your-rails-appbenutzen.
Möchte aber gerne das die Modell Dateien _tabnav.rb in
einen anderen Ordner ‘installieren’ werden, also nicht in
app_name/app/models/_tabnav.rb sondern in
app_name/app/navigation/*_tabnav.rb
Der Standard Befehl ist:
ruby script/generate tabnav Main
ich hatte an so etwas gedacht:
ruby script/generate tabnav tabnav/Main
aber das funktioniert (natürlich) nicht.
hat da jemand schon Erfahrung? oder eine Idee?
thx
kallle
du kannst dir ja mal den generator anschauen und es da einfach drin
ändern…
gruß
manuel
jeah,
das hab ich auch schon geschaut. aber ich weiss dann nicht ob das an
einer
anderen stelle zusammenbricht. ist auch eher kosmetik. werd aber noch
die
lösung posten wenn ich sie gefunden hab.
greets
kalle
rails aufräumen …
Die Lösung liegt in der enviremont.rb:
Add additional load paths for your own custom dirs
config.load_paths += %W( #{RAILS_ROOT}/extras )
config.load_paths += Dir["#{RAILS_ROOT}/app/navigation"]
config.load_paths += Dir["#{RAILS_ROOT}/app/mailer"]
somit kann man einfach die tabnav erstellen mit:
ruby script/generate tabnav tabnavName
Dann einfach die erstellten Dateien in den gewünschten Ordner
verschieben,
fertig ist ein aufgeräumte Verzeichnis Struktur. Auch “chic” für den
ActionMailer
greets kalle
Hallo Kalle,
Am Mon, 5 Nov 2007 11:25:43 +0100 schrieb “kalle saas”
[email protected]:
rails aufräumen …
Sorry, habe deinen Beitrag erst jetzt gelesen. Schau dir mal Folgendes
an: http://www.therailsway.com/2007/6/4/free-for-all-tab-helper
Eine Auflösung dazu gibt es auch noch:
http://www.therailsway.com/2007/6/28/free-for-all-tab-helper-summary
Gerade die dort als erstes präsentierte Lösung ist wirklich elegant und spart
dir den ganzen Ärger, den du mit solchen Plugins hast. Aber schau einfach
mal selbst, ob das was für dich ist
Beste
GrüßeMoritz